A new season with a new captain and new coach for Kings XI Punjab will be kickstarted by revisiting an age-old rivalry, as they take on a familiar foe in Delhi Capitals on Sunday, September 20 at the Dubai International Stadium. Both sides have rejigged their roster to an extent since last season, putting a focus on getting young players into their setup and those prodigies will be put to the test on Sunday in the Dream11 Indian Premier League.

Kings XI Punjab have the upper hand in the head-to-head record against the Delhi Capitals, winning 14 out of the 24 games. Last season, honours were even as KXIP beat the Capitals in Mohali and Shreyas Iyer’s team won the game at the Arun Jaitley Stadium. 

These two sides met on the opening day of the 2018 season of the IPL, and Kings XI Punjab fans would fondly remember that game being the one where KL Rahul scored the fastest fifty in the history of the competition.

Shikhar Dhawan got five fifties in the 2019 season of the IPL, which included a match-winning one against Kings XI Punjab as well. With his experience and caliber at the top of the order, Dhawan has been a proven matchwinner in the past and if he gets a good start it could spell trouble for KXIP. 

KL Rahul has been the top run scorer for Kings XI Punjab in two consecutive seasons, and fans of the franchise will hope for the same to continue that form in 2020 as well. Rahul has the added responsibility of captaincy as well this season, and will look to lead from the front and start off with a big score in IPL 2020.

Kagiso Rabada was the second highest wicket-taker in the 2019 edition of the IPL, finishing one below Purple Cap winner Imran Tahir. With his searing pace and pinpoint yorkers, Rabada should be the marquee bowler for Delhi Capitals this season as well, but it will be interesting to see how he adjusts to the slowish pitches of the UAE. 

Mohammed Shami ended as KXIP’s leading wicket-taker in 2019, with 19 scalps to his name. He was the go to player for Kings XI Punjab last year whenever the team needed a wicket in the late stages, and that responsibility will be augmented further with seamers Andrew Tye and Ankit Rajpoot moving on from the team. Shami has been a key competent of Kings XI Punjab during the training sessions since the past few weeks and will be expected to be a key player of the squad in 2020.

With two young squads with lots of promising players this season, both KXIP and DC will be hopeful to make a strong, positive start to the tournament. KXIP could take solace from the fact that they have always beaten Delhi Capitals when they played them first up in an IPL season, and also from their invincible record in the UAE.

Kings XI Punjab were bolstered by the news that Glenn Maxwell will be eligible for the game and can slot straight into that middle-order for the team. As far as the rest of the batsmen go, with no injury concerns reported yet, coach Anil Kumble will most likely pick this experienced combination to help his side start off well. 

Ravi Bishnoi and Mujeeb ur Rahman bring the mystery element to the team, and both have been in good form this year. Krishnappa Gowtham with his IPL experience and explosive batting could slot into that number seven position to give the team the right balance.
